ABSTRACT

Children healthcare and gender discrimination are a real challenge to China in the process of achieving its Millennium Development Goals (MDGs) In this study, we investigate the influence of mothers’ education on the health status of their children in the context of China The data are derived from the China Family Panel Studies (CFPS) which comprises information from 16,000 households and individuals collected from 25 provinces across China except for autonomous zones The result shows that maternal education strength affects children’s health, and household wealth as well as gender and living area slightly impact on child health The study is one of the first research to estimate the influence of maternal education on child health by quantile regression while the historical papers used OLS or fixed effect to research those influences Quantile regression is employed to analyze the impacts of mothers’ education on child health under different quantiles of the child’s body index variable

JEL classification: I14, I24

Keywords: Child health, maternal education, household wealth, BMI, China.

Ecological systems theory: This theory looks at a child’s development within the context of the system of relationships that form his or her environment Bronfenbrenner’s theory defines complex “layers” of environment, each having an effect on a child’s development This theory has recently been renamed “bioecological systems theory” to emphasize that a child’s own biology is a primary environment fueling their development The interaction between factors in the child’s maturing biology, their immediate family or community environment, and the societal landscape fuels and steers its development Changes or conflict in any one layer will ripple throughout other layers To study a child’s development then, we must look not only at the child and her immediate environment, but also at the interaction of the larger environment as well

Figure 1: Bronfenbrenner’s Ecological systems theory

Trang 15

Bronfenbrenner’s theory includes the following layers:

First, the microsystem is the layer closest to the child and contains the structures with which the child has direct contact The microsystem encompasses the relationships and interactions a child has with her immediate surroundings (Berk, 2000) Structures in the microsystem include family, school, neighborhood, or childcare environments At this level, relationships have impact in two directions - both away from the child and toward the child For example, a child’s parents may affect his beliefs and behavior; however, the child also affects the behavior and beliefs

of the parent Bronfenbrenner calls these bi-directional influences, and he shows how they occur among all levels of environment The interaction of structures within a layer and interactions of structures between layers is key to this theory At the microsystem level, bi-directional influences are strongest and have the greatest impact

on the child However, interactions at outer levels can still impact the inner structures

Second, the mesosystem is the layer provides the connection between the structures of the child’s microsystem (Berk, 2000) Examples: the connection between the child’s teacher and his parents, between his church and his neighborhood, etc

Third, the exosystem is the layer defines the larger social system in which the child does not function directly The structures in this layer impact the child’s development by interacting with some structure in her microsystem (Berk, 2000) Parent workplace schedules or community-based family resources are examples The child may not be directly involved at this level, but he does feel the positive or negative force involved with the interaction with his own system

After that, the macrosystem is layer may be considered the outermost layer in the child’s environment While not being a specific framework, this layer is comprised

of cultural values, customs, and laws (Berk, 2000) The effects of larger principles defined by the macrosystem have a cascading influence throughout the interactions of all other layers For example, if it is the belief of the culture that parents should be solely responsible for raising their children, that culture is less likely to provide resources to help parents This, in turn, affects the structures in which the parents

Trang 16

function The parents’ ability or inability to carry out that responsibility toward their child within the context of the child’s microsystem is likewise affected

Finally, the chronosystem which is a system encompasses the dimension of time as it relates to a child’s environments Elements within this system can be either external, such as the timing of a parent’s death, or internal, such as the physiological changes that occur with the aging of a child As children get older, they may react differently to environmental changes and may be more able to determine more how that change will influence them

From Bronfenbrenner’s (1986) ecological theory, these factors include maternal education (microsystem level), maternal and family involvement in children’s home activities (microsystem level), maternal and family involvement in children’s school activities (mesosystem level), and the social support (exosystem level)

Also, the ecological theory views child outcomes as dependent upon the characteristics of the child, parent, family, school, community, and larger society, as well as the interactions among these variables However, some researchers have argued that this traditional ecological framework is limited because it does not adequately consider variables such as social position (e.g., social class, ethnicity, race, and gender), social stratification (e.g., racism, prejudice, discrimination, and segregation), and adaptive culture (e.g., traditions and cultural legacies, migration and acculturation, economic and political histories) experienced by family members of color who are born in the United States or other countries To address this problem, Garcia Coll et al (1996) proposed an integrative model to study the development of competence in children of color, by considering both social position and social stratification constructs at the core rather than at the periphery of a theoretical formulation of children’s development In this model, the researchers address some important factors omitted or neglected in mainstream ecological models, such as experiences of racism and segregation, intragroup variability and diversity within minority group families, and the effects of social stratification and acculturation on the developmental competencies of minority group children

In this study, the main hypothesis is that maternal education may affect children health at least in the following two ways First, women with more years of education have higher production and allocation efficiencies in their children’s health production (Grossman, 2006) Production efficiency means better health condition with given health production input, while allocation efficiency means optimal combination of different health inputs with given budget Maternal education can raise both production and allocation efficiencies, and thus improve children’s health Second, higher maternal education can also affect the amount of inputs of children’s health production More educated women have higher labor market income (labor market effect) and “match” with better educated and higher income husbands (assortative mating effect), while more family resources and better family environment contribute to children’s health human capital accumulation (McCrary and Royer, 2011)

2.2.1 The impact of maternal education on child health

The mother’s education in most of papers are measured by the number of year

of schooling

The relation between mother’s education and child health has long been supported by many evidences Barrera (1990) researched the impact of mother’s education on child health in which the indicator for good or bad child health is determined by height – for – age scores The regression result shows a positive effect

Trang 18

of maternal education on child nutritional outcomes Also, mother’s education improves children’s height – for – age

Similarly, the effect of maternal education on three markers of child health is examined in 22 developing countries (Desai and Alva, 1998) The markers of child health consist of the probability of infant death, children’s height – for – age, and immunization status The ranking of level educational mother includes 2 levels, mother not educated and secondary educational level The result indicates that there is

a consistent association between mother’s education and infant mortality Meanwhile, the correlation between maternal education and children’s height – for – age is positive and significant Although the coefficient correlation of mother’s education on immunization status is small, this effect is statistically significant in sample countries

Moreover, the effect of mother’s schooling on child health is can also be seen

in the case of Morocco (Glewwe, 1999) The study also suggests that there is a positive relationship between education and child health However, in this case, the evidences indicated that it is not only education but also the effect of household wealth that leave an impact on child health

The association of maternal education with child health may arise because educated mothers are considered more efficient “producers” of good child health (“productive efficiency”) by adopting better child-care practices or superior hygiene standards Alternatively, it could be because they choose health input mixes that generate more health output (“allocative efficiency”) than selected by less-educated mother

Another studies used natural experiments to identify mother’s education-child health relationship Breierova and Duflo (2004) used the 1995 intercensal survey of Indonesia and school data from the Sekolah Dasar program to investigate the impact

of parents’ education on fertility and child mortality The results show a positive and significant effect of the school program on parents’ education and a negative effect on fertility Both father’s and mother’s education were found to reduce child mortality The authors found little evidence to support the intuition that the mother’s education effect is stronger than the father’s Similarly, using a natural experiment from Taiwan

Trang 19

(a new compulsory education law), Chou et al found evidence of a causal relationship between parents’ education and child health, but contrary to the previous study, mother’s education was found to be stronger effect than father’s education No pathway investigation was attempted in either study

Maternal education in child health functions may therefore be affected by different factors (at the level education of the father, household welfare and place where child born) A study by (Thomas, Strauss et al., 1990) in Brazil analyses the role of income, mother’s literacy and information processing, and the interaction of maternal schooling with community services The authors find that for most of time all the impact of maternal schooling on child height can be explained through mother’s access to information (i.e exposure to media)

Besides, some authors have found a significant effect of maternal education on child health status while others argue that there is little or no evidence of a causal relationship For instance, Frongillo, de Onis, and Hanson (1997) ran cross-country OLS regressions of child height-for-age (stunting) and weight-for-height (wasting) on education variables, food security, geographic region and other variables They found that the female literacy rate had a significantly negative effect on stunting The main shortcoming of this study is that it did not address the heterogeneity in child health endowment and did not use instrumental variables methods to address the endogeneity

of female literacy rate While Martorell, Leslie, and Moock (1984) found no evidence

of an impact of parents’ education on child health outcomes Baya (1998), using data from a town in Burkina Faso, found that after controlling for father’s education, the effect of mother’s education on child survival loses significance He concludes that studies on parents’ education and child health status should not focus on mother’s education

Handa (1999) examined six pathways through which mother’s education might affect child health outcomes: income effects, interactions with household characteristics, interactions with community services, information processing,

Trang 20

unobserved household heterogeneity1, and intrahousehold bargaining power Using data from Jamaica, Handa found that information processing is found to be a pathway through which mother’s education affects child health outcomes Handa argued that he was able to control for unobserved household heterogeneity He used the fact that in Jamaican households there are usually children from different mothers, and women in the same household care for all children whether the children are their own or not This is questionable because there is likely to be mother heterogeneity The other limitations of this study include treating parents’ education as exogenous, and using unobserved household heterogeneity as a pathway; it is really an estimation problem, not a pathway

Webb and Block (2004), using household survey data from Central Java, Indonesia, found that a mother’s nutritional knowledge is a determinant of child short-term nutritional status (weight-for-height) whereas her schooling is a determinant of long-term nutritional status (height-for-age) These authors could not find plausible instrumental variables for maternal nutritional knowledge and household expenditures, so they used proxy variables to estimate reduced form equations for child nutritional status Webb and Block did not account for the possibility of omitted variable bias that would result from the heterogeneity of child health endowment Appoh and Krekling (2005), using data from the Volta Region in Ghana, found that mother’s nutritional knowledge is more important than mother’s schooling in determining child weight–for-age However, these authors accounted neither for the simultaneity of inputs choices, nor the endogeneity of mother’s health knowledge

After all, recent research on the relationship between maternal schooling and child health has moved towards underpinning the ‘pathways’ in which mother’s education translates into the improvement in child health While a majority of the evidence has not directly controlled for the endogeneity of maternal schooling, introducing different ‘pathways’ is one way of isolating the ‘true’ impact of maternal education from the effect of confounding factors In a recent study, (Glewwe, 1999)

2.2.2 The role of household wealth

Household wealth plays an important role in child health (Filmer and Pritchett, 1999) The construction of household wealth index includes the following indicators: first, consumer durables (family owns a radio, television, bike or motorbike or car, etc); second, drinking water sources; third, type of toilet; fourth, household has electricity or not; fifth, the number of bed room; sixth, type of material for floor in house Some factors are used as control variables to analyze the effect of other factors such as maternal education (Boyle, Racine et al., 2006)

Meanwhile, household wealth is measured by net worth, values of businesses and private accounts (Shanks, 2007) The result shows that wealth is a relevant factor associated with child development

The effect of household wealth on child health is similar to the impact of economic development level on child health It can be explained that improving the material status of the family and purchasing goods and services can lead to better health It can be considered that poverty is an important determinant of mortality and poor health in all countries (Wagstaff, 2002) Furthermore, the evidence advocates that there are likely to be positive monotonic relationships between household wealth and child health in most developing countries (Gwatkin, 2000)

2.2.3 The effect of development economic on health

Following a number of previous studies, the level of regional economy is measured by the income of a nation, particularly by GDP per capita based on purchasing power parity In some countries, there would be a negative relation between life expectancy and income inequality (Preston, 1975) Surprisingly, mortality rate in Jamaica is better than Brazil even though the country’s GDP per capita is lower, which has mortality worse than expectation (Filmer and Pritchett, 1999)

The region inequality in health system was demonstrated in Lorenz curve and Kuznets hypothesis (Fang Dong et al., 2010) The Lorenz curve shows that regional health inequality in China is related to socioeconomic factors and health system Also, the Kuznets hypothesis to test the influence of GDP per capita on health distribution The result of testing of Kuznets hypothesis indicated that health inequality had not reached its peak, meaning that China is still laying on the left side of the Kuznets curve

Deaton (2003) captured evidences for the association between national income and health The results indicate that GDP per capita is significantly related to the probability of death in developed countries Besides, the effect of income inequality

on health in developing countries is bigger than in developed countries This study used National Health Interview Survey (NHIS) with observation sample of approximately 50,000 households in every year, the National Health and Nutritional Examination Survey (NHANES) which surveyed more than 14,000 people in the first round between 1971 and 1975, and the Panel Study of Income Dynamics (PSID) which has followed around 5,000 households (and their children and split-offs) since

1968 The author used all data to find out the interaction among mortality, income, and income inequality A logit model was applied to estimate the log odds of death during the ten-year follow up as a linear function of age including dummy variables for each of the seven income groups These logits are estimated for white males and females separately, using data only for those aged 18 to 75 at the time of first interview (The log odds of mortality are approximately linear in age over this range.)

Trang 23

In order to conduct a state-level analysis, each of these models is fitted to data for a single state, thus allowing inequality or any other state-level produce an unrestricted effect on the relationship between mortality and income In findings, income inequality becomes relatively more important as a cause of death at higher income levels
